$70,000 Warren’s Thoroughbred Stakes
WENDY’S ON TO ME

INGLEWOOD, Calif. (Apr. 24, 2005) – Longshot Wendy’s On to Me got up in the final strides to edge favorite Del Mar Miss and win Sunday’s $70,000 Warren’s Thoroughbreds allowance stakes for California-bred fillies and mares, the second race on the Gold Rush VI card at Hollywood Park.

Wendy’s On to Me is by Avenue of Flags, out of the Northern Baby mare Northern Advantage, was bred by Mickey Ruis and owned by Alvin M. Ruis. He was ridden by Corey Nakatani, trained by Tony Locke, ran the seven furlongs in 1:23.35 and went off at odds of 35-1.

Wendy’s On to Me broker her maiden in her most recent race, her 13th attempt.

Del Mar Miss was second and Valid’s Valid was third.
